Been making kydex sheaths for about a year and a half now with no problems. A few days ago I made a sheath and I could not pry the pieces apart after molding on both pancake and taco style sheaths. I 've had this happen a very few times and just chalked it up to a bad piece of kydex. I've tried to make a sheath seven times now with the same results each time so I've decided my kydex is not the problem. I have not changed the way I make my sheaths AT ALL. I still do everything from start to finish exactly the same. I have not changed or replaced any of my tools or accessories. The only two pieces of equipment I could figure that could have possibly malfunctioned were my touchless thermometer and my heat source (I use a griddle) so I replaced them both and still got the same results. It was suggested to me that my kydex was getting to hot, even though I used the same setting as always, so I reduced my heat 20 degrees and got the same results. Does anybody have any ideas as to what the problem might be? I'm at my wits end and this is getting expensive. Any help would be greatly appreciated. Thanks.
